How people contribute — volunteering, unpaid care and domestic work, and defence service.
Much higher volunteer rates than most similar areas define Capella, where 20% of people give their time to others. This strong spirit of helping out is seen across the community, and the number of volunteers has risen by 8.7 percentage points since 2011.
Volunteering for organisations and groups.
One in five people in Capella volunteers, a figure that is well above the 14.1% seen across both Queensland and Australia.

Caring for others and unpaid domestic work.
A high 30.8% of residents provide unpaid childcare, which is well above the national figure of 26.3%. While 23.7% do significant housework, those providing other types of unpaid care are few at 7.8%, which is well below the state and national rates.

People who served in the Australian Defence Force.
People who have served in the Defence Force make up 2.6% of the population, which is much lower than most similar areas.
